📘 Title Name: Rule by Fear – Eight Theses on Authoritarianism in Pakistan
✍️ Author: Ammar Ali Jan
🖋️ Foreword by: Tariq Ali
📦 Publisher: Folio Books
🔹 Introduction:
This groundbreaking book examines the roots and realities of authoritarianism in Pakistan. Ammar Ali Jan presents eight theses that uncover how fear is cultivated to maintain control over society and politics.
🔑 Key Points:
-
Explores the historical evolution of authoritarian structures in Pakistan.
-
Highlights the role of state institutions in perpetuating control through fear.
-
Analyzes the political, social, and cultural consequences of authoritarianism.
-
Draws connections between global authoritarian trends and Pakistan’s experience.
-
Encourages readers to rethink democracy, resistance, and social justice.
🔻 Conclusion:
Rule by Fear is an essential text for those seeking to understand Pakistan’s political landscape. By blending historical insight with critical analysis, Ammar Ali Jan provides a powerful lens to challenge fear-based governance and imagine democratic alternatives.
